What is Masco's share buybacks?
Masco (MAS) reported share buybacks of $202M in Q1 2026.
How has Masco's share buybacks changed year-over-year?
Masco's share buybacks increased by 55.4% year-over-year, from $130M to $202M.
What is the long-term trend for Masco's share buybacks?
Over 3 years (2021 to 2025), Masco's share buybacks has grown at a -17.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.03B to $571M.
What does share buybacks mean?
Cash spent by the company to buy back its own stock.
How do you interpret share buybacks?
High repurchases often signal management's confidence in the stock's value or a strategy to improve earnings per share.
